Default hello, im new and looking for a personal development buddy

i've listened to all the podcasts and read 10+ articles

i joined the forum hoping that i might find a personal development buddy to share exercises with since i think this will motivate me more.

i've thought about asking friends but since a lot of my friends don't really talk about this kind of stuff i thought this forum might be a better place to start.

i have completed a quarterly review on the topics of:

work, financial, relationship, home and family, physical healthy, mental, social, emotional, spiritual, character, contribution, fun and adventure

giving myself marks out of 10 and writing a short paragraph on each

i've also written an exercise asking myself what a 10 out of 10 mark would be for each area

next im going to write an exercise asking how i can use 'overwhelming force' to achieve these goals...

i guess i was looking for feedback and someone else interested in doing these exercises and sharing their results, experiences...
